Drinking sugarcane juice during a weight loss journey can indeed be tricky. While it’s rich in nutrients like iron, magnesium, and potassium, and contains some antioxidants, the high natural sugar content can make it problematic for weight management if consumed in excess. Sugarcane juice can impart vitality and, in Ayurvedic terms, may benefit Pitta dosha due to its cooling nature, but should be enjoyed mindful of its sugar and caloric density.
The key here is moderation. You might find it helpful to treat sugarcane juice as an occasional indulgence rather than a daily habit. If you’re aiming for weight loss, think of it as part of your overall plan, not as a go-to beverage. Additionally, consuming it in the morning or post-exercise can allow for better energy utilization of the sugars ingested.
Consider pairing sugarcane juice with a bit of lime juice and ginger, which not only enhances the flavor but also may support digestion and metabolic fire (agni). This can aid in breaking down sugars more efficiently, reducing the likelihood of disrupting your weight loss efforts.
Pay close attention to your own body’s reaction and energy levels. You might find that having a small glass once or twice a week satisfies your cravings without derailing your goals.
